FOREIGN BUYERS SURCHARGE — REVENUE
1076. Hon
Dr STEVE THOMAS to the minister representing the Treasurer:
I refer to the McGowan government's
foreign buyers surcharge, which was applied in the 2017 state budget as four
per cent and increased to seven per cent in May 2018.
(1) What income
has the foreign buyers surcharge raised for each of the financial years 2018–19
to 2021–22 inclusive?
(2) How many transfers of
residential properties did the surcharge apply to in each financial year?

AnswerView source ↗
I thank the Leader of the Opposition
for some notice of the question.
(1)–(2) Revenue
from the foreign buyers surcharge and all other revenue items is published in
the state budget, midyear review and Annual report on state finances each year, while the Department of Treasury publishes some historical data in
its annual overview of state taxes and royalties. The revenue and number of
residential property transactions for each year is provided in tabular format.
I seek leave to have this information incorporated into Hansard .
[Leave
granted for the following material to be incorporated.]
�
2018–19
2019–20
2020–21
2021–22
Revenue
($m)
5.5
19.0
17.3
21.7
Residential
Property Transactions
208
570
550
597
